What Olympia’s bonus is really giving you

The verified welcome structure is a standard match-style bonus with free spin winnings tied into the same wagering calculation. On paper, that sounds simple: deposit, receive bonus funds, and work through turnover before cashing out. In practice, the value depends on how much of your own bankroll you are prepared to risk while clearing the requirement.

The key verified point is the 40x wagering requirement applied to bonus plus free spin winnings. For experienced players, that immediately puts the offer into the “high friction” category. It is not the kind of promo you clear casually in a short session, and it is not built for low-turnover punting. If you like structured bonus play, the math is at least clear. If you want flexibility, the terms are less forgiving.

Bonus element What it means Value impact
Welcome bonus Deposit match style offer Useful only if you can meet turnover without breaching rules
Wagering requirement 40x on bonus plus free spin winnings Heavy clearance burden
Bet cap while active Maximum stake per spin is restricted Raises the risk of accidental breach and weakens flexibility
Excluded games Many titles contribute little or nothing Reduces efficient turnover options
Withdrawal thresholds Different methods have different minimums Can trap smaller balances if you choose the wrong cashier route

The most important takeaway is that Olympia’s promo value is not determined by the headline percentage alone. It is determined by whether your preferred games, deposit method, and cashout plan can survive the terms.

Banking and cashout friction for AU players

For Australian players, the cashier matters as much as the bonus itself. Verified information shows that the cashier separates deposit and withdrawal methods, which can create traps if you do not plan ahead. That is especially important when you are working through a promo and expect to withdraw a modest win.

The verified minimums are worth noting. Neosurf deposits can start from 20 AUD, cards and crypto equivalents from 25 AUD, and bank transfer withdrawals have a 200 AUD minimum. That gap is a genuine issue for small and medium stakes players. A punter who deposits a modest amount and clears the bonus to a small win may find the withdrawal path narrower than expected.

Method Role Practical note for AU players
Visa / Mastercard Deposit only Can work for deposits, but withdrawals are not the route
Neosurf Deposit only Useful for privacy and lower starting amounts
Crypto Deposit and withdrawal Most flexible option if you are comfortable with wallet handling
MiFinity Deposit and withdrawal Can be workable, but first cashout timing may still depend on checks
Bank transfer Withdrawal High minimum and slower processing make it less suited to smaller balances

From a value perspective, crypto and MiFinity are the cleaner paths once you have verified your account. Cards and bank wires can still be part of the picture, but they are not the strongest fit for bonus grinders. For a lot of Australian players, the real question is not “Can I deposit?” but “Can I get the money back without extra friction?”

Risks, trade-offs, and where the offer catches players out

This is where Olympia’s bonus becomes less about headline generosity and more about rule discipline. The verified facts point to several recurring issues: delayed withdrawals, KYC loops, and strict enforcement of bonus conditions. That does not make the site unusable, but it does mean the offer is not forgiving.

The biggest risks are easy to identify:

  • Max stake breaches: If you exceed the bonus bet limit, winnings can be at risk.
  • Excluded games: Some titles contribute poorly or not at all to wagering, so game choice matters.
  • Withdrawal mismatch: A small win can become awkward if the only available withdrawal route has a high minimum.
  • Verification delays: First cashouts may trigger extra checks, especially when documents are not perfectly clear.
  • Offshore dispute limits: The operator sits under Curacao regulation, so Australian consumer protections do not apply in the same way they would with a domestic operator.

There is also a broader structural issue: the verified analysis shows the standard welcome bonus has negative expected value under reasonable slot assumptions. That does not mean nobody can benefit. It means the offer is not mathematically generous once turnover cost is factored in. In plain English, the bonus can still be entertainment value, but it is weak as a long-term edge.

That is the right lens for experienced players. Treat the bonus as a controlled-play tool, not a strategy for building profit.
